Well we use different strength nutes for different weeks right now we are at day 10 sitting at 400ppms ph 5.6. Temps 82 try to get the rh to 60 but usually about 50-55, 1500 ppms of CO2 but decreasing CO2 and increasing nutes as we go. We change the water out around once a week depending on how the plants are. Yes we top up with hot 600-700 ppms if not plants eat about 100ppms a night. We don't really use a schedule.

I have 2 reservoirs that I can use for the top off one is a hundred gallons and the other is fifty. I also have the option of using just straight ro water if needed. I just watch my plants and the ppms and attach which ever I feel is best either the top off hose or the ro hose. Normally I use the 50 gallon to top off and keep the 100 gallon to fill and make the change out water in then when the top off is used up I fill that also for the change out and that pretty much fills my system. I don't necessarily start with a weaker ppm the goal is to keep that ppm and the plants drink about 100ppms a night so the top off should just keep it where its at.
